    Abstract: Concepts and technologies are disclosed herein for a topology aware load balancing engine. A processor that executes a load balancing engine can receive a request for a load balancing plan for an application. The processor can obtain network topology data that describes elements of a data center and links associated with the elements. The processor can obtain an application flow graph associated with the application and create a load balancing plan to use in balancing traffic associated with the application. The processor can create the load balancing plan to use in balancing traffic associated with the application and distribute commands to the data center to balance traffic over the links.

    Abstract: There is provided an autonomous distributed type file system which is connected to a data reference device through a first network. The autonomous distributed type file system includes a plurality of storage device units which are mutually connected through a second network and are connected to the first network. Each of the storage device unit includes a local storage and a local controller. The local controller includes a storage directory and a duplicated data maintaining unit. The duplicated data maintaining unit refers to the storage directory, and continuously keeps same contents of duplicated data items in a range without running out of storage capacity of an own node. When there is no free space in the storage capacity, duplicate writing of the data with the same contents is prevented.

    Abstract: A server computer, upon receiving a signal for a write request to a storage device from a management computer, performs a provisional write, which is a write related to the write request signal, to a first storage part in the server computer, and sends a first notification signal indicating that the provisional write has been completed to the management computer. The management computer, upon receiving the first notification signal, transmits a second notification signal indicating that the management computer has received the first notification signal to the server computer. The server computer, upon receiving the second notification signal, performs write processing to the storage device. Thereby, a failure caused by dual execution of write processing to the disk is prevented when transferring processing from a main server to an auxiliary server in a case where the main server fails with regard to processing accompanying writing to the disk.
